Description
The eerie journey continues in this gripping third installment, where suspense and horror intertwine in unexpected ways. Adam Cesare delves deeper into the twisted world of Frendo, a notorious figure whose presence looms large over the small town. The narrative unfolds against a backdrop of cornfields and crumbling rural life, where the line between reality and terror blurs.
As the characters grapple with their fears, they uncover dark secrets about the Church of Frendo, an enigmatic entity that holds sway over the community. The story is rich with tension and vivid imagery, reminiscent of the haunting landscapes painted in classic horror. Each page unravels the psychological torment plaguing the residents, who find themselves ensnared in Frendo’s malevolent web.
Cesare’s mastery of suspense keeps readers on edge, crafting a tale where every corner hides a potential danger. As the stakes rise, the struggle for survival becomes a test of courage, loyalty, and the human will to confront one’s darkest nightmares.
